Sr. Manager, Sourcing - Aftermarket Parts
RheemAbout the role
The Strategic Sourcing Manager will be responsible for developing and executing a comprehensive sourcing strategy that aligns with the organization's objectives. This role will foster a culture of collaboration and agility, ensuring close alignment with various functions and providing clarity on the sourcing process, roles, and responsibilities. This role requires a strategic leader with a deep understanding of sourcing strategy and HVAC distribution who can balance enterprise directives with local business needs. The ideal candidate will leverage resources from the parent company to develop impactful sourcing initiatives, drive business growth, support increased market share, and bolster sales performance across all distributorships.
This role is pivotal in driving the organization's sourcing strategy, ensuring efficiency, and fostering strong relationships with stakeholders and suppliers. If you are a strategic thinker with a passion for sourcing and procurement, we encourage you to apply.
This position can be based in any of the regions in which Rheem operates its distribution network and will both lead the sourcing efforts of Rheem Air Distribution as well as spearhead cross-business unit opportunities for shared categories and suppliers between RAD and our Rheem Parts Division. Our ideal candidate is located in Randleman, NC. We may be open to other locations including a headquarters for Distribution - Houston,TX, Kimberly, WI, Islandia, NY, Burlington, NJ, or Dayton, OH.
- Develop and Execute Sourcing Strategy: Create, manage, and execute a comprehensive sourcing strategy that aligns with the organization’s objectives.
- Business Strategy Alignment: Ensure alignment of business strategies across markets and business units to drive efficiency and scale.
- Efficiency and Impact: Increase efficiency by driving scale where it makes sense, decreasing fragmentation, and prioritizing higher impact areas.
- Technology and Data Utilization: Leverage technology and data to drive performance that unlocks growth.
- Collaboration and Agility: Foster and build a culture of collaboration and agility to enable an efficient and effective sourcing process.
- Stakeholder Relationships: Establish influence within the organization, evaluate existing practices, and challenge the status quo when necessary. Foster strong, trusting relationships with stakeholders and business partners.
- Contract Management: Draft, review, and negotiate contract terms with suppliers to ensure favorable terms and compliance with legal and organizational requirements, including defining services, deliverables, acceptance criteria, service level agreements (SLA), and key performance indicators (KPI).
- Market and Spend Analysis: Conduct in-depth market and spend data analysis to inform sourcing decisions.
- Supplier Performance Management: Develop and utilize supplier scorecards and savings tracking. Facilitate effective supplier performance management by providing feedback and proactively addressing performance issues.
- Support Network: Define and utilize a robust support network to ensure close alignment in strategy with functions.
- Other duties as assigned.
- Bachelors Degree in related field
- 10+ years of professional sourcing experience, with a focus on distribution sourcing in the HVAC industry, aftermarket, parts & supplies or equivalent combination of education and experience. Aftermarket parts experience highly preferred. HVAC industry experience highly preferred.
- 8+ years of experience in sourcing strategy development, ideally within a distribution or manufacturing environment
- Strong analytical skills to structure and solve complex business challenges, developing data-driven strategies, and analyze in-depth market and spend data
- Proven experience in strategic sourcing, procurement, commodity management or supply chain management in an industry related field
- Excellent negotiation skills and experience in drafting and reviewing contracts.
- Ability to build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ders and suppliers.
- Proficiency in leveraging technology and data to drive sourcing performance.
- Strong leadership and collaboration skills to foster a culture of agility and efficiency.
- Excellent facilitation and communication skills, both written and verbal, with a keen attention to detail and accuracy in messaging
- Proven ability to thrive in a dynamic team environment, demonstrating dedication to teamwork, a strong work ethic, and adaptability to new challenges and ideas
- Proficient computer skills and in-depth knowledge of relevant software such as MS Office Suite.
